WB27K10354 GE Oven Control To9 (Gas)

WB27K10354⁢ GE oven Control To9 (Gas)⁤ is an ⁤electronic ⁢oven control module​ used in General Electric gas⁢ ranges and ⁤built-in ovens. It is indeed‍ a printed circuit‍ board assembly that integrates the⁤ user interface (clock/timer and keypad), a microcontroller, power⁢ supply componentsand output⁤ switching elements (relays or triacs) to manage oven functions. The component is‍ a system-level control board rather than ​a simple mechanical thermostat,‍ and it is typically‌ mounted⁢ behind the control panel where it‌ connects to the front‍ user ⁣controls ⁤and the appliance wiring harness.

Inside⁤ the ‍appliance,the ‍control ⁢coordinates timing,temperature ​regulation,and⁤ safety interlocks⁢ by communicating with the ⁤oven temperature sensor,igniter and⁣ gas‍ valve circuit,door/latch sensors (where applicable),and​ any diagnostic feedback mechanisms. It supplies line‍ voltage to heating/ignition circuits⁤ when conditions are met, reads resistance or voltage ‌from the temperature sensor to regulate ⁤bake/broil cyclesand ⁤interprets user ⁣inputs from the keypad ⁤or selector switch. ‍Because the control sits ⁣at the intersection of low-voltage logic ⁣and line-voltage⁤ power⁢ outputs, ​it interacts with the appliance power‍ supply, connector‌ harnessesand safety devices that⁣ prevent unsafe ignition or operation.

Function‍ and Role of Electronic Oven Control Modules⁢ in Gas Ranges

The electronic oven control board⁢ designated‌ WB27K10354 GE oven Control ⁢To9 (Gas) acts as the ⁢central ⁤timing⁤ and temperature management⁣ module for compatible GE gas‌ ovens. It‌ reads⁤ the oven temperature ⁢sensor, executes the⁢ control algorithm that ‌times igniter firing and gas valve ⁤actuationand provides ‌the user interface and diagnostic reporting. Internally the board contains switching ​devices (relays or triacs)‌ and circuitry to sequence the ignition cycle,​ monitor ‍safety interlocks (such as door lock during self-clean)and respond to sensor inputs;⁢ it does not independently generate flame ⁣but energizes the igniter ​and the gas valve circuit according to programmed logic.⁣ When replacing this⁢ part, verify​ the ⁢printed part number,⁢ connector pinout and‌ harness compatibility since different ‌control revisions may share⁤ similar⁣ housings but use different firmware ⁢or​ wiring arrangements.

operational ‌behavior and practical troubleshooting ‌centre⁢ on the control’s ability to sense temperature and reliably switch outputs. ⁢Common service observations that implicate ​the control⁢ include non-responsive bake/broil functions, persistent error codes on the ⁤display, ​an igniter that receives power but‌ the gas valve never opensor temperature drift where the oven overshoots ⁢or fails​ to maintain setpoint. Technicians should confirm ‌line voltage, inspect connector continuityand verify ‍the‌ oven ⁣sensor reading before condemning the control; when⁢ fitting a replacement WB27K10354 board,‍ transfer‌ any mounting brackets and⁣ ensure ​sensor ⁢harnesses are connected to⁢ the correct ‌terminals. ‌For ‌safe, prosperous ‌repairs, match the board‍ part number and⁢ harness configuration and⁣ consult the oven’s ⁤wiring diagram ‌or ⁤service manual for‌ the exact pin-to-function mapping.

How the WB27K10354 GE Oven Control ​To9‍ (Gas) Interfaces with ⁣Sensors,Gas Valves,and the User Control​ Panel

The WB27K10354 GE Oven Control To9 (Gas)‌ is the ⁤central electronic module that coordinates temperature sensing,ignition sequencing,gas-valve ⁢actuation,and ⁤the ⁣user interface.The ⁤board accepts inputs from the oven temperature sensor (thermistor) and the flame-sensing circuit, interprets user commands from the control ⁤panel,⁣ and then applies the ⁢appropriate control signals to the ‌ignition/valve assembly; failures‌ or out-of-range sensor readings will prevent valve energization‌ and place the​ control into fault⁢ or ‌lockout modes. In practice, technicians verify sensor continuity ‍and correct ​resistance profiles, confirm⁤ connector pinouts, ⁣and⁣ observe whether ‌the ‍board ‌issues⁢ a valve-drive ‌signal or ignition pulse when a call for heat is⁢ made.

Functionally, the control provides switched outputs to the ignition ‌and gas valve circuits and⁣ monitors feedback through the flame-sense and safety interlock inputs; the flame-sense⁣ loop detects rectified current from⁣ the burner so the controller can ⁤confirm​ combustion before holding the ‌valve open. Compatibility requires matching the‌ board’s connector layout and firmware‍ to the oven‌ model-mismatched boards may have different ignition timing, sense thresholdsor ‍pin ⁤assignments and ⁢will not⁤ operate reliably. For example,​ an ⁢open thermistor will be ‌interpreted as a cold-fault and will keep‍ the ‌gas‌ valve de-energized, ⁣whereas a valid thermistor reading ‍combined with successful flame detection allows ‌normal bake cycles to⁣ proceed under⁤ user-selected ⁣setpoints.

Common Failure Symptoms​ and Diagnostic Indicators for WB27K10354-Controlled gas Ovens

The‌ WB27K10354 GE Oven Control To9 (Gas) ⁢ is the main electronic‍ module ⁣that coordinates user inputs, timing, ⁢safety⁣ interlocksand the switching of bake/broil relays for ‍gas ovens. In⁢ normal operation the board reads the oven ‍temperature sensor, drives the‌ gas valve/igniter⁢ circuit, ⁣and ⁤displays status or ​error codes to the user interface. Failures ⁣of this control typically present ⁣as a mix of electrical ⁤and functional symptoms rather than purely cosmetic issues: the display may be⁢ blank or erratic, front-panel commands may​ not register, the igniter ‌may cycle without​ opening the valveor the oven⁣ may ⁢not maintain⁣ set temperature. Because this⁣ board interfaces‌ directly​ with power, the harnessand the oven temperature sensor, correct compatibility (matching⁢ harness⁢ pinout and control firmware/revision)‍ is required⁤ to avoid ⁣unexpected behavior after replacement.

  • No display, unresponsive keypador ⁣incorrect error codes ⁣appearing ‌during operation.
  • Igniter glows but​ no gas​ flow / ‌continuous ‌attempts to ignite (relay output present but⁤ no valve response).
  • Oven⁣ temperature overshoots, fails to reach ⁣setpointor ​shows persistent temperature error due to sensor reading ‍faults or ⁢control regulation failure.
  • Intermittent operation or failures that⁤ correlate with⁣ vibration or heat cycles,suggesting failed solder ⁣joints‍ or degraded⁢ components ⁢on the ‌control.

Diagnosing faults requires separating the control’s ‍outputs from the external loads: ⁤use⁤ a‍ multimeter to confirm expected⁤ line voltage at the relays when a bake or broil ⁤cycle⁤ is commandedand compare the oven sensor⁢ resistance to the manufacturer’s ⁢curve at⁤ room ‌temperature. A‍ control that ⁢drives the correct‍ voltage to the gas valve but the oven ‌still fails to ‌heat indicates a downstream gas valve or igniter problem; conversely,correct valve operation with no drive signal implicates the control. Practical troubleshooting ‌steps include visually inspecting the board for burnt components or ⁣cold solder joints, checking⁢ connector continuity, ​logging error codes displayed during failed cyclesand performing⁣ live-voltage checks only ⁣with appropriate safety precautions (power disconnected⁤ when changing harnessesand reconnect for measurements). Replacing the control ⁣without verifying‌ sensor,‍ igniterand valve operation can lead to unneeded parts⁤ swaps and repeated failures.

Compatibility, Replacement Considerationsand Installation ​Guidelines⁣ for WB27K10354⁤ GE Oven Control To9 (gas)

WB27K10354 GE Oven Control To9​ (Gas) ⁤is ‍the ⁤main electronic interface and power-distribution board for compatible‍ GE ‌gas ovens; it ⁢interprets user inputs, runs the oven’s ⁢bake/broil timing ⁢and sequencingand ⁣drives⁤ outputs such as the ‌gas valve, glow igniter circuit, oven lamp,⁣ and display. The ‌board monitors ‍temperature feedback (thermistor/RTD) ‌and safety interlocks ⁤(door switches, flame sensor where applicable)⁣ and ⁢contains ‌relay or⁢ triac outputs⁤ that switch 120 VAC loads.⁣ Typical behavior includes a self-test/diagnostic mode⁢ accessible at power-up ⁢and a requirement that correct line voltage and ‍solid ⁢grounding be present⁤ for reliable operation;‌ intermittent display ‌faults, failure ‍to igniteor ⁤relays that hum are symptomatic of control-side⁤ issues ⁣rather than mechanical components.

When replacing the ‌controller, verify ‌harness pinouts, connector keying, ‍and the board’s ⁢mounting footprint against the oven ⁤model number rather​ than ⁣assuming interchangeability by⁣ appearance. Before installing a‍ replacement,measure ‌the ⁣thermistor resistance at room temperature,confirm 120 VAC is present at the board’s line⁢ terminals with‌ safety switches closed,and inspect the ⁢original board for failed ⁢capacitors or heat damage that could indicate upstream problems. ⁤After installation, run the oven through a bake ⁤cycle‌ and compare oven temperature to ‌an external oven thermometer; if the board provides an adjustable⁣ offset or calibration setting,⁣ adjust according to ⁤the measured deviation and re-check ignition sequencing⁤ and diagnostic codes to ‍confirm correct operation.

Q&A

What is the WB27K10354 and what does​ it control⁢ on a GE ⁤gas oven?

The⁤ WB27K10354 is⁤ an electronic oven‍ control (main control board) used on manny GE gas ranges. It manages ​the oven ⁣user interface (clock, temperature‌ setpoints, timers),‍ and the power outputs ​that control the bake/broil ⁤functions, igniter/gas‍ valve ‌timing, oven light, ​and display. It does not‌ physically open⁢ the‍ gas valve by mechanical means but switches ⁤the electrical circuits that drive the igniter⁣ and ⁤gas valve/safety ⁣system.

What are ⁣common⁤ symptoms that indicate the WB27K10354 control ‌board⁣ is‌ failing?

Common signs include a blank or non-responsive display, oven functions​ (bake/broil) not turning on while ‍other functions work, intermittent operation, error⁣ codes related to ‍the⁤ controlor ⁢relays ⁤clicking but no heat.You ⁤may also see inconsistent ⁣temperature ‌control or an oven that ⁢won’t enter ‌bake/broil⁢ even though the igniter and⁣ gas supply are⁢ good. Burnt components ‍or visible damage on ‍the​ board are also⁤ indicators.

Do ‍I need to program ​or configure the WB27K10354 after replacing ⁤it?

In ⁣most GE gas ranges the control board ⁣is a plug-and-play replacement and does⁣ not require additional​ software programming after installation; settings like clock and user preferences‌ may need to be re-entered.⁣ However, always consult the range’s service manual‍ for ​model-specific procedures-some models​ require a ⁢simple‌ setup or calibration routine when a new⁤ board ‍is installed.

Can I ‌test the ​WB27K10354 myself,and‍ how do I do basic diagnostics safely?

Basic checks you can perform safely: (1) With power off,inspect the board for burnt traces,swollen ​capacitors,or loose connectors.‌ (2) Verify incoming line voltage to the board with⁢ a​ multimeter (with power on and proper safety precautions) – it typically uses mains voltage. (3) Measure output circuits when a heat cycle is commanded: the board should provide⁣ the expected output voltage to the igniter/gas valve/relay terminals. Also check the oven ⁤temperature ⁣sensor resistance (typical⁤ NTC sensors are ⁤~1,000-1,100 ohms at room temperature). If you are not⁢ comfortable working with live mains⁤ voltage or gas-related components, hire ⁤a qualified technician-working on these⁢ systems can be dangerous.

If ⁣the oven won’t ignite, ⁣how can I determine whether the⁤ control‍ board,‌ igniteror ‍gas‌ valve is at fault?

Troubleshoot in steps:‌ (1)‌ Check for proper spark/igniter glow ‍when‍ a bake/broil cycle ⁣is selected. ⁢if the igniter doesn’t glow, ⁤test ⁤the ⁣igniter for continuity and correct ‌resistance per the ‌range’s⁤ service manual. (2) ⁣If the igniter glows but the burner doesn’t ​light, the‍ igniter may not be ⁢drawing ‍sufficient ‌current to open the ⁤gas ‌valve-this can⁣ be due to a ​weak igniter or ⁣a faulty⁢ gas safety valve. (3) ‍If the board ⁣never sends voltage to the igniter/gas valve, the control board⁤ or its relays may be ⁢faulty. ⁢Use a multimeter to ‌verify whether the board ⁣is supplying the expected voltage during a​ call for heat (exercise caution with live ‍testing).

Are ther⁢ any safety‍ precautions I should take‍ when replacing the WB27K10354?

yes. Always disconnect electrical power to⁤ the appliance at‌ the circuit‍ breaker ⁤before servicing. ‍Turn off the gas supply ‍if you will be disconnecting gas-related ⁢components. Avoid working‌ on a live control board ⁤unless you are⁣ trained and have the‌ correct ⁤tools; live-voltage testing ‌should only be done by qualified personnel. Make sure​ connectors are re-seated ‍firmly, replace any brittle⁣ wiring⁣ or damaged harnessesand‍ verify there are no shorts or exposed conductors​ before restoring power⁢ and ‍gas.

How do I calibrate ⁤the oven temperature after⁣ installing a ‌new WB27K10354?

Most ‌ovens allow a user‌ temperature⁢ adjustment via the control panel (check ⁤the owner’s ⁢manual​ for the procedure). If you need ‌a more⁣ accurate calibration, place ⁢an ‍oven thermometer in the center of the oven, heat to ‌a set temperature (for example 350°F), ⁢and compare readings.​ Adjust the oven⁤ temperature offset in the control if available. If the range⁣ does not ⁢have a user adjustment or ⁢temperature​ is grossly inaccurate, further⁣ diagnosis of ‍the‍ oven sensor ⁣and heating components is needed.
